Best Schools in West End, IL
West End, IL has a total of 8 schools including 3 high schools, 3 middle schools and 2 elementary schools. A total of 1,472 students attend West End, IL schools. On average, schools in West End score 14%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 18%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in West End don't me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in West End, IL
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
West End, IL has a total population of 181 with 21%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 84%, and 15%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
